EXPEDITION WEEK "When Crocs Ate Dinosaurs" on National Geographic Channel

Watch a sneak peek of EXPEDITION WEEK "When Crocs Ate Dinosaurs" which airs tonight, Saturday, November 21 at 9PM ET/PT on the National Geographic Channel.
Synopsis: EXPEDITION WEEK "When Crocs Ate Dinosaurs" - Some hundred million years ago, crocodiles were the ruling T. rexes of the waters. They galloped on land, ambushed prey at the river’s edge … even terrorized dinosaurs. And more, these swift predators evolved through the ages into the modern crocs we know today. Now, armed with newly discovered prehistoric crocodile bones, Explorer-in-Residence Dr. Paul Sereno is determined to bring the ancient creatures to life — and tell their fantastic untold story. Learn about a croc that pursued prey across land, a supercroc that locked its jaws around dinos, with a startlingly canine face. Blending art, forensics and biology, a team reanimates a lost world of strange Cretaceous crocs that paleontology forgot.

EXPEDITION WEEK "The First Jesus?" on National Geographic Channel

Watch a sneak peek of EXPEDITION WEEK "The First Jesus?" which airs tonight, Friday, November 20 at 9PM ET/PT on the National Geographic Channel.
Synopsis: EXPEDITION WEEK "The First Jesus?" - He was called the King of the Jews, believed to be a Messiah. Just before Passover, the Romans beheaded him and crucified many of his followers outside Jerusalem. But his name was not Jesus ... it was Simon, a self-proclaimed Messiah who died four years before Christ was born. Now, new analysis of a three-foot-tall stone tablet from the first century B.C., being hailed by scholars as a "Dead Sea Scroll on stone," speaks of an early Messiah and his resurrection. Dog Whisperer Season 6 with Cesar Millan Debutes on Tuesday, October 6

[Press Release - Released by National Geographic Channel]
In five seasons and more than 100 episodes, Cesar has seen every canine case imaginable ― red-zone aggression, fearful anxiety and just plain weird. But never before has he shown viewers how they can avoid these problems from the very start! In the sixth season premiere of DOG WHISPERER WITH CESAR MILLAN: How to Raise the Perfect Dog, Cesar goes back to the basics, adopting four adorable pups and filming them living with him and his pack for their first eight months to show viewers how to avoid problems from the very start.

National Geographic: Climbing Redwood Giants

[Press Release - Released by National Geographic]
They are living giants -- among Earth's largest and longest-lived trees. Some tower higher than 350 feet, or taller than the Statue of Liberty; some may have been seedlings when Jesus was born. These natural legends house secret-garden worlds high up in their canopies and shroud centuries-old mysteries.
This fall, National Geographic magazine and National Geographic Channel (NGC) journey deep into the great redwood forests on the American West Coast for an illuminating look at these magnificent wonders -- from the outermost edges of the forest to the tip of a single tree's crown. For the first time, we'll size up the health and future of the redwood range on foot and scale the trees' hulking limbs 30 stories up to glimpse rich canopy ecosystems in the clouds. RESCUE INK UNLEASHED on The National Geographic Channel

Think Law And Order but for Animals.
[Press Release - Release By National Geographic Channel]
(WASHINGTON, D.C. -- AUGUST 18, 2009) In New York's war on animal abuse, some of the worst offenders are pursued by a group of tattooed motorcycle-riding tough guys on a mission to save animals in danger. They call themselves Rescue Ink, and these are their stories.
In a metropolitan area with more than 20 million residents, thousands of animals -- dogs, cats, and even chickens and piranhas -- are neglected, abused, hoarded or housed illegally. A few years ago, eight tough guys from the mean streets, who frequented hot rod shows and tattoo parlors, discovered their strongest bond was actually a passion for animals -- and they formed a rescue organization like no other.
